It was another exciting week for the Gilmour boys 16-U hockey team. The Lancers took on Saint Edward High School's JV team on the road midweek and came away with an impressive 7-1 victory.  
 
Gilmour then finished the week in Castle Shannon, Pa., with a two-game series against Tier 1 Pittsburgh Predators AAA. Assistant Coach Gordon Glass referred to the series as a "true test of the team's talent."
 
The morning game saw the Predators take an early 6-3 lead. But as soon as the second period took off, so did the Lancers, unleashing an onslaught of scoring. Gilmour led 9-7 late in the game before surrendering one final goal to hang on for a 9-8 win.

In the afternoon game, the Lancers came out a bit flat and lost 6-3 in a disappointing showing considering the talent displayed in the day's opener.

Overall, in the eight games against Tier1 AAA Pennsylvania rivals this season, Gilmour is 2-5-1.
 
"All of the games were competitive and are reflective of the growing strength of the program," said Glass.
